Definition File Whitelist:

Describes a method in information technology to define a list of trusted and clean files. Everything that is not on a trusted whitelist has to be considered as untrusted and possible unsafe. Untrusted files need much effort for analyze whether they are a security threat or safe.

This free whitelisting service contains hashes of clean files from original sources of the ventors only. The database covers Microsoft DOS, Windows 95, Windows 98, Windows ME, Windows NT, Windows 2000, Windows XP, Windows Vista, Windows 7, Windows 8, Windows 10 and common applications from major ventors. Many details are shown, e.g. the file name, file size, operating system, file dependencies, MD5 checksum, SHA1 checksum and other file characteristics.
